§ 66-7-405 — Minimum vehicle size

A. It is unlawful to operate on the highways of this state any motor vehicle:

(1)with a wheelbase, between two axles, of less than three feet four inches;
(2)with a motor displacement of less than forty-five cubic centimeters; or (3) any motorcycle with less than a twenty-five inch seat height measured from the ground to the lowest point on the top of the seat cushion, without a rider. B. For the purpose of this section, wheelbase shall be measured upon a straight line from center to center of the vehicle axles.
